Directed by Luis Llosa, Anaconda follows a documentary film crew in the Amazon rainforest who are hijacked by a paranoid snake hunter (played brilliantly by Jon Voight). Their mission: capture a giant, legendary green anaconda—alive. What ensues is a claustrophobic game of cat-and-mouse on a boat, as the serpent picks off the crew one by one.

In India, under the Cinematograph Act and the Copyright Act of 1957 (amended in 2012 and 2021), uploading, downloading, or streaming pirated content is illegal. The Delhi High Court has ordered ISPs to block sites like Tamilyogi. While users are rarely prosecuted, accessing the site violates federal law. Production houses (like Sony Pictures, which owns Anaconda) can track downloads.
